ESA Gaming signs distribution agreement with Betfair

The Flutter-owned sports betting exchange will now offer ESA’s gaming portfolio to players in the Italian market.

Supplier ESA Gaming has announced a new agreement with Betfair, which will see the operator gain access to ESA’s full gaming portfolio and Game Aggregator System for distribution via its Italian platform.  

As per this new arrangement, ESA’s full slot portfolio, including titles such as Chicken Bonanza and Santastic 4, will go live on the Betfair platform. Additionally, content from ESA’s third-party providers will also be integrated as part of the new deal.  

Over the past 18 months, ESA Gaming has entered into a phase of expansion in the Italian market, initially entering a partnership with NetBet Italy in July 2023 – a move that was subsequently followed by an additional Italian-based collaborative effort with Microgame in September 2023.

This year also saw the supplier integrate its gaming content with Betpoint in the Italian market in June. Most recently, the company expanded its pre-existing arrangement with Betsson into the Italian market – launching its gaming portfolio on the Starcasino brand.  

Good to know: Following Flutter’s Q3 2024 results, CEO Peter Jackson named Italy as a key region for expansion  

Speaking on this most recent announcement, Thomas Smallwood, ESA Gaming Chief Commercial Officer, said: “Partnering with a major Flutter brand is an exciting moment for us as we further consolidate our position as a leading aggregator and supplier in Italy. With a wealth of top-performing content, it’s another milestone deal for us and we look forward to working closely together.” 

For Betfair, this new partnership follows the announcement of Newcastle FC legend Alan Sherer as the company’s latest brand ambassador in May. More broadly, the brand’s parent company, Flutter, has had a busy month this November, recording its highest closing price on the New York Stock Exchange, as well as appointing a new UK & Ireland CEO in Kevin Harrington.
